1The Lord said to Moses, “Speak to the priests, the sons of Aaron, and say to them:[#Lev 19.28; Ezek 44.25]
“No one shall defile himself for a dead person among his relatives,
2except for his nearest kin: his mother, his father, his son, his daughter, his brother;
3likewise, for a virgin sister close to him because she has had no husband, he may defile himself for her.
4But he shall not defile himself for those related to him by marriage and so profane himself.
5They shall not make bald spots upon their heads or shave off the edges of their beards or make any gashes in their flesh.[#Lev 19.27; Deut 14.1; Ezek 44.20]
6They shall be holy to their God and not profane the name of their God, for they offer the Lord ’s offerings by fire, the food of their God; therefore they shall be holy.[#Lev 3.11; 18.21; #21.6 Or the ’s gifts]
7They shall not marry a prostitute or a woman who has been defiled; neither shall they marry a woman divorced from her husband. For they are holy to their God,[#vv 13, 14]
8and you shall treat them as holy, since they offer the food of your God; they shall be holy to you, for I the Lord , I who sanctify you, am holy.
9When the daughter of a priest profanes herself through prostitution, she profanes her father; she shall be burned to death.
10“The priest who is exalted above his brothers, on whose head the anointing oil has been poured and who has been consecrated to wear the vestments, shall not dishevel his hair nor tear his vestments.[#Lev 10.6, 7; 16.32]
11He shall not go where there is a dead body; he shall not defile himself even for his father or mother.[#Lev 19.28]
12He shall not go outside the sanctuary and thus profane the sanctuary of his God, for the consecration of the anointing oil of his God is upon him: I am the Lord .[#Ex 29.6, 7; Lev 10.7]
13He shall marry only a woman who is a virgin.[#v 7; Ezek 44.22]
14A widow or a divorced woman or a woman who has been defiled, a prostitute—these he shall not marry. He shall marry a virgin of his own people,
15that he may not profane his offspring among his people, for I am the Lord ; I sanctify him.”
16The Lord spoke to Moses, saying,
17“Speak to Aaron and say: No one of your offspring throughout their generations who has a blemish may approach to offer the food of his God.[#v 6]
18Indeed, no one who has a blemish shall draw near, one who is blind or lame, or one who is mutilated or deformed,[#Lev 22.23; #21.18 Meaning of Heb uncertain]
19or one who has a broken foot or a broken hand,
20or a hunchback, or a dwarf, or a man with a defect in his eyes or an itching disease or scabs or crushed testicles.[#Deut 23.1]
21No descendant of Aaron the priest who has a blemish shall come near to offer the Lord ’s offerings by fire; since he has a blemish, he shall not come near to offer the food of his God.[#v 6; #21.21 Or the ’s gifts]
22He may eat the food of his God, of the most holy as well as of the holy.
23But he shall not come near the curtain or approach the altar because he has a blemish, that he may not profane my sanctuaries, for I am the Lord ; I sanctify them.”[#v 12]
24Thus Moses spoke to Aaron and to his sons and to all the Israelites.
